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,323,155,092
Lastest Block:
1,959,312
Utxos:
1,983,715
Nodes:
351
OmniXEP Contracts:
274
Block details
[STAKE]
10/04/2025 17:03:28 UTC
Txid
5f40eea8dc90b1ac7acfcdb6d793a0143bc0b6f1112ea70a2e8b2f2bf04d86f0
Block
1,690,937
Block hash
b78d70759ea0e23be437ebc8c91d5dc8f2b628a6313fd5eb0950440d5a8a1aa7
Stake amount
124.01563179 XEP
Sender
ep1qxcaeqyw6sntffxge3dtadg820lrh87zd6jffs3
Recipient
ep1qxcaeqyw6sntffxge3dtadg820lrh87zd6jffs3
(2,033,350.85297993 XEP)